	I have the C. It doesn't seem all that robust to me, having
broken two of them already. Know of any other options for this sort of
thing? 

> 
> > 	So I've just now broken for the second time the thing that
> > plugs my etherlink iii into my 10baseT cable. The first time I broke
> > it I just bought a new card, but that's really not a good long term
> > solution. 
> > 	Is there some way I can just buy the things? 
> 
> Nope.  Are you using the 3C589B or 3C589C card?  The newer model (C) has
> a much better connector than the older models.  I have both, and I
> prefer the newer style as it 'seems' more robust.
